Transaction cef7215c58de391f141b7deb041ec61901ccdaf9835f75303edae8f7f6984024
1 Input
1 Output
-
cef7215c58de391f141b7deb041ec61901ccdaf9835f75303edae8f7f6984024:0
- value
- 668443776
- script pubkey
- OP_0 OP_PUSHBYTES_20 5768a78ce8c38a5f9eda24f533a45c4d44780527
- address
- bc1q2a520r8gcw99l8k6yn6n8fzuf4z8spf84u8mda